In the wake of a significant security breach involving the cryptocurrency exchange Bybit, valued at an astonishing $1.4 billion, the industry is left grappling with the implications for its security protocols and infrastructure. The breach, which did not compromise Bybit’s core infrastructure but instead stemmed from a flaw in the Safe developer’s machine, highlights critical weaknesses in the broader framework of decentralized finance (DeFi) and security practices.

Understanding the Breach

Initial investigations revealed that the hacking incident was executed via a vulnerability in Safe’s AWS S3 bucket, where external actors ingeniously manipulated the wallet front end. According to Safe’s report, which was corroborated by Bybit’s forensic team and blockchain security firms such as Sygnia and Verichains, the attackers employed a compromised machine to submit a cleverly disguised malicious transaction proposal. This proposal integrated harmful JavaScript into essential resources, which enabled the assailants to alter transaction details during the signing process.

Public records and analysis of the incident indicated that the malicious code injection took place directly in the Amazon Web Services (AWS) environment, representing a stark example of the ease with which attackers can leverage existing infrastructure. Through a calculated approach, the hackers undoubtedly aimed at potential high-value targets, which included Bybit’s contract address alongside an additional unidentified contract, presumably under their control. Such precision suggests a targeted assault rather than a scattergun approach.

Following the execution of the malicious transaction, Safe promptly uploaded updates to its JavaScript resources on its AWS infrastructure, erasing traces of the compromised code. However, forensic investigators successfully traced the attack vector, linking it to the infamous North Korean hacker group Lazarus. This state-sponsored group is notorious for its adept use of social engineering techniques and zero-day exploits to breach developer credentials, emphasizing the growing sophistication of cyber threats facing the cryptocurrency ecosystem.

Despite the immediate efforts to rectify the situation, experts pointed out systemic flaws that allowed the attack to happen in the first place. Yu Xian, founder of SlowMist, echoed a critical sentiment that such vulnerabilities could extend beyond Safe’s platform, potentially threatening all user-interactive services that rely on similar front-end frameworks. He noted that standard security measures, such as Subresource Integrity (SRI) verification, could have thwarted the attack. SRI provides a crucial layer of defense by ensuring that browsers validate the integrity of resources fetched from the web.

The aftermath of this incident has left a resounding impact on discussions regarding security within the cryptocurrency space. Safe, responding to the breach, committed to a comprehensive review of their systems and infrastructure. They cleared their smart contracts and front-end source code from vulnerabilities while implementing necessary changes to enhance security further.

However, criticisms arose not only towards Safe but also towards Bybit’s security protocols. Hasu, the strategy lead at Flashbots, emphasized that Bybit’s infrastructure must be assessed and held accountable for allowing such a breach to occur. He argued for the necessity of adopting a mindset where front-ends are considered compromised by default, advocating for comprehensive signing processes that can withstand such vulnerabilities.

Similarly, Jameson Lopp, chief security officer at Casa, offered critical insights suggesting that no developer should possess production keys on their machines, and that production code should always undergo thorough peer reviews. This consideration raises alarming questions about the security protocols and checks in place during the development phase. Mudit Gupta, the chief information security officer at Polygon Labs, echoed similar sentiments, lamenting the lack of oversight regarding who had the authority to implement changes on Safe’s production website.

The Bybit hack serves as a stark reminder of the lingering risks that pervade the cryptocurrency and DeFi sectors. The incident not only unveiled vulnerabilities tied to single-point failures in security but also highlighted the need for a collective effort to bolster security protocols across decentralized platforms. The onus lies not only on individual companies to upgrade their internal processes but also on the industry as a whole to adopt a more collaborative approach toward enhancing security measures.

As the DeFi landscape continues to expand, the insights gleaned from the Bybit breach should catalyze a profound reassessment of how organizations handle security, transaction verifiability, and user trust. Future initiatives must emphasize transparency, robust vetting processes, and comprehensive security protocols to fortify the very foundations of DeFi applications.

Exchanges

Articles You May Like

The Surge of Trading Volume on Coinbase’s International Exchange
The Bitcoin Market: Correction or End of Bull Market?
The Evolution of Binance: A Safe Haven for Institutional Investors
The Impact of Spot Bitcoin ETF Approval on the Crypto Futures Market

Leave a Reply

Your email address will not be published. Required fields are marked *